BWXT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

293 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BWX Technologies (BWXT)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$4.79B — up 13% from $4.25B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 59 funds opened new BWXT posit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 108 added to existing stakes and 84 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Victory Capital Management, adding an estimated $37.4M. The largest seller was Capital International Investors, cutting an estimated $80.1M.
